Where the New Orleans Saints will need help without Michael Thomas – Canal Street Chronicles
Looking at how Michael Thomas’s absence will affect the Saints by analyzing his production over the last two seasons.
New Orleans Saints’ Sean Payton says Michael Thomas’ surgery should’ve happened before June – ESPN
Sean Payton expresses his disappointment with the timing of Michael Thomas’s surgery.
Wil Lutz, P.J. Williams start Saints training camp on non-football injury list – Saints Wire
Kicker Wil Lutz and defensive back P.J. Williams are on the non-football injury list, though neither player is expected to miss significant time.
Former Saints head coach, WDSU analyst Jim Mora’s HOT TAKE on NOLA QB battle between Taysom & Jameis – WDSU
Former Saints head coach thinks that a “special team” needs a “special quarterback,” but does not believe that either Taysom Hill or Jameis Winston are special.
New Orleans Saints sign WR Chris Hogan – New Orleans Saints
The Saints officially announce the signing of Chris Hogan.
Marquez Callaway wears new No. 1 jersey at Saints pictures day – Saints Wire
According to an Instagram post from Tre’Quan Smith, it looks as though Marquez Callaway will be wearing the #1 jersey.
Saints continue working toward 100 percent vaccination – Fox 8 Live
Mickey Loomis says that the team is on track to reach 90% vaccination, while Sean Payton hopes that they can reach 100% vaccination.
